Long-term care insurance agents in Windsor Locks help residents plan for future care needs. Connecticut offers the Partnership for Long-Term Care program which allows policyholders to protect assets while qualifying for Medicaid. Agents can explain how this state-specific program works with private insurance policies.

What Does a Long-Term Care Insurance Agent in Windsor Locks Cost?

Long-term care insurance premiums in Connecticut vary based on age health and coverage amount. A typical policy for a 55-year-old might cost between 150 and 300 dollars per month. Costs increase with age and for added benefits like inflation protection. This is general information not insurance advice.

Frequently Asked Questions

What does a long-term care insurance agent in Windsor Locks do?
An agent helps you compare policies from different carriers and explains coverage options. They also advise on Connecticut Partnership plans which provide asset protection under state law.
What is the Connecticut Partnership for Long-Term Care?
It is a state program that lets you keep assets equal to the benefits paid by your policy if you later need Medicaid. An agent can help you choose a Partnership-qualified policy.
